I just bought a 29" Liz Claiborne Pullman and also a Samsonite 25" Pullman. I like both but will take one back. i LOVE the 29" Liz Claiborne one but the measurements add up to exactly 62"..so I couldn't expand it (which is fine). However, Southwest's baggage policy is nothing bigger than 62". Will i get by with the Liz Claiborne one or should I go with a 25"? We're flying this trip, but normally drive.
 
It's going to be hard keeping the 29" Pullman under 50 lbs. I'd return that bag. You'll be OK with the size but if you fully pack that bag it can wind up weighing up to 70 lbs.
